Ibutamoren is a growth hormone secretagogue that stimulates the release of growth hormone. In humans, aging is associated with a decrease in HGH secretion to less than a third of that of a 20-year-old, and thus lower levels of circulating IGF-1. Lower IGF-1 levels lead to decreased strength and muscle mass and increased truncal fat accumulation.

How Does Ibutamoren Work?

Ibutamoren, also known as MK-677, is a selective agonist of the ghrelin receptor. Ghrelin is a hormone that stimulates the release of growth hormone and increases appetite. By binding to and activating the ghrelin receptor, ibutamoren increases the secretion of growth hormone and insulin-like growth factor 1 (IGF-1) in the body.

Ibutamoren has been found to increase lean body mass and reduce body fat, which makes it a popular compound in bodybuilding and fitness circles. It may also improve bone density, muscle strength, and exercise performance.

It is important to note that ibutamoren is not approved by the FDA for any medical use and is classified as a research chemical. It may have potential side effects and interactions with other medications, so it is important to consult with a healthcare professional before using ibutamoren.

Ibutamoren Side Effects

What are the side effects of Ibutamoren?

Ibutamoren can cause the following side effects:
Common Ibutamoren Side Effects
  • Water retention, which can lead to swelling or edema of the lower extremities
  • Increased appetite
  • Increased blood sugar which can cause reactive hypoglycemia with shakiness, sweating, and dizziness.
  • Lightheadedness
  • Fatigue
  • Muscle pain
  • Joint pain
  • Tingling fingers and toes
  • Shortness of breath
  • Flushing
  • Sleepiness
  • An increase in cortisol and prolactin levels, at least temporarily
